Role

We are seeking a dynamic and results-driven Partner Business Manager to join our UK team. This role focuses on recruiting new partners and supporting existing ones, with a primary emphasis on driving new business through Talkdesk partners. The successful candidate will spend approximately 70% of their time on the road, collaborating closely with partners to build and execute go-to-market (GTM) strategies, deliver training, attend events, and work with Account Executives (AEs) and Solutions Engineers (SEs) to maximize partner-driven growth.

Key Responsibilities
  • Partner Recruitment: Identify, recruit, and onboard new partners to expand Talkdesk’s partner ecosystem in the UK.
  • Partner Support & Enablement: Provide ongoing support to current partners, including training and resources to enhance their ability to sell Talkdesk solutions.
  • New Business Development: Drive revenue growth by collaborating with partners to generate new business opportunities and close deals.
  • Go-to-Market (GTM) Strategy: Develop and execute tailored GTM plans with partners to align with Talkdesk’s business objectives.
  • Events & Engagement: Represent Talkdesk at industry events, partner meetings, and joint marketing initiatives to strengthen relationships and brand presence.
  • Collaboration with Internal Teams: Work closely with AEs and SEs to ensure alignment between partner activities and Talkdesk’s sales strategies.
  • Performance Tracking: Monitor and report on partner performance metrics, ensuring KPIs and revenue targets are met.
Key Requirements
  • Proven experience in partner management, business development, or a similar role within a B2B SaaS or technology environment.
  • Strong understanding of channel sales and go-to-market strategies.
  • Excellent relationship-building and communication skills, with the ability to influence and engage partners.
  • Willingness to travel extensively (70% of time) across the UK to meet with partners and attend events.
  • Ability to collaborate effectively with cross-functional teams, including AEs and SEs.
  • Self-motivated, proactive, and results-oriented with a track record of driving new business.
  • Familiarity with CRM tools (e.g., Salesforce) and partner management platforms is a plus.
